What Exactly Does a Headphone Amplifier Do?

At its core, a headphone amplifier is an electronic device designed to increase the power of an audio signal, sending a clean, robust signal to your headphones. Think of it like a specialized power booster for your headphones. The audio output from most standard devices—like smartphones, tablets, or computer sound cards—is often weak and unrefined. While sufficient for basic earbuds, it simply can’t provide the necessary voltage and current to drive higher-end headphones to their full capabilities.

Powering Demanding Headphones

Many high-fidelity headphones, especially audiophile-grade models or certain professional studio headphones, have high impedance and/or low sensitivity. Without adequate power, these headphones will sound quiet, dynamic range will be compressed, and details will be lost. An amplifier provides the necessary voltage and current to properly drive these headphones, allowing them to perform exactly as their designers intended. This proper pairing is essential for achieving optimal sound improvement.

Overcoming Weak Source Limitations

The audio output stages in many common devices are built for convenience and cost-efficiency, not for pristine audiophile gear performance. These built-in digital-to-analog converters (DACs) and amplifiers can introduce noise, limit dynamic range, and simply lack the power to properly drive quality headphones. A dedicated amplifier bypasses these limitations, taking a cleaner signal from your source and amplifying it with precision and fidelity.

DAC vs. Amplifier vs. DAC/Amp Combo: What’s the Difference?

It’s common for newcomers to audio to confuse DACs and amplifiers, or wonder if they need both.

  • DAC (Digital-to-Analog Converter): This component converts digital audio signals (like MP3s, FLAC files, or streaming audio) into an analog electrical signal that your headphones can play. Most devices have a built-in DAC. For superior conversion, many audiophile gear setups include an external DAC. Learn more about choosing one in our guide to the best DACs for headphones.
  • Amplifier: This component takes the analog signal from the DAC and boosts its power, making it strong enough to drive your headphones efficiently.
  • DAC/Amp Combo: Many modern devices integrate both a DAC and an amplifier into a single unit. These are often excellent solutions for simplifying your setup while still achieving significant sound improvements.

While an amplifier alone is crucial for powerful headphones, pairing it with a quality external DAC (or using a combo unit) ensures that the signal being amplified is as clean and accurate as possible from the start.

When Might You NOT Need a Headphone Amplifier?

It’s true that not every headphone user needs an amplifier. If you primarily use highly sensitive, low-headphone impedance headphones or earbuds designed for mobile use (typically below 32 ohms impedance), your phone or laptop might be sufficient. These headphones are engineered to be easily driven by low-power sources. However, even with easier-to-drive headphones, a dedicated amplifier can still offer a noticeable uplift in dynamics, clarity, and overall control, transforming merely good sound into truly great sound.

How do I know if my headphones need an amplifier?

You likely need an amplifier if:

  • Your headphones sound too quiet, even at maximum volume on your device.
  • The sound lacks detail, punch, or dynamics (it sounds “flat”).
  • Your headphones have a high impedance (e.g., 50 ohms or more) or low sensitivity (often measured in dB/mW). These specifications usually indicate they require more power.
  • You notice distortion, especially at higher volumes, from your source device.
